MDMX/MDM2-IN-2 is a potent dual inhibitor of the p53-MDM2/MDMX interaction, exhibiting inhibition constants (Kis) of 0.23 µM for MDM2 and 2.45 µM for MDMX. This compound effectively disrupts the binding of p53 to MDM2 and MDMX, thereby restoring p53's function, which leads to cell cycle arrest and apoptosis. Additionally, MDMX/MDM2-IN-2 demonstrates inhibition of cell migration and invasion, highlighting its potential for therapeutic applications in cancer research. Its antitumor activity makes it a valuable tool for studying tumor biology and exploring novel cancer treatment strategies.
